Head to head by decade

Decade Slovenia Zimbabwe Difference Ahead
1990s 12,875 t 60,875 t 48,000 t Zimbabwe
2000s 2,473 t 19,989 t 17,515 t Zimbabwe
2010s 3,130 t 0 t 3,130 t Slovenia
2020s 2,012 t 0 t 2,012 t Slovenia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
